A tight and scrappy game where they scored with their only shot on goal.
We started well and there were three chances in the first 5 minutes. A cross from Jed was headed over, a long range effort from Evans on the half way line did not catch out their retreating keeper and a header from Cooper following a corner. We looked up for it but they looked like spoilers in the middle. There was a lot of scrappy play where we moved the ball well but they gave us no space to develop our attacks. Jed looked lively, Danny made some good runs down the right and Molly got forward at every opportunity. We just didn't look enough of a threat in the final third to score a goal. At times it looked promising but it fell apart when we got close. Dutch was having a tight game in the middle, Saville was trying hard to create a chance but Evans looked off the pace and really never improved throughout the game. The game was not helped by a ref who missed all the obvious stuff and let the game flow but pulled it back when there was not need. It all ended up being stop start and frustration was growing in the crowd. Surely GR could see the weakness in the middle and correct it at the break as the half finished goalless.
There were no changes for us at the break but they made a change. The second half needed a decent pass or a chance in front of goal but we had to wait a while before it eventually came. A surprising cross field pass from Ballard found Molly in space on the left. He hit his cross first time and Jed stole in on the right to side foot it home. It was a goal worthy of winning any game. The Den erupted but there was no music! We continued to press forward in search of a second but never really created a decent chance. Smith came on for Benik and Leonard came on for Saville but it really should have been Evans going off. There was a firm challenge on their right which didn't really look a foul but the ref gave it. The free kick was flat and hit with pace and their Brereton glanced it home. Bart stood no chance. It was their only shot on goal. Mitchell came on for Evans near the death but forgot his magic wand to turn the game. They had a man down for ages near the end and you would have thought he had broken both legs. After extensive treatment with the magic sponge he struggled to get up but was running around like a greyhound in thirty seconds. We piled on the pressure at the death but to not avail and the game ended all square.
Bart had little to do and could do little to stop their goal as it was right in the corner. Danny had a decent game was aggressive and made some good runs down the right. Murray was solid in the middle and Cooper tried so hard to score from set pieces but the MOM was Ballard. He never missed anything and his cross field pass to set up the goal was excellent. Dutch was busy and full of hustle and bustle, Saville had his moments but Evans was average at best. Jed was busy, took his goal well and Benik had some good movement and touches. Smith was his normal one dimensional self, Leonard added some bite in the middle and Mitchell hardly broke sweat.
All in all a scrappy game which we had the better of but just couldn't turn our advantage into a a second goal and they were very lucky to come away with a point. They have had the Indian sign over us for far too long so, at least with a draw we have stemmed the tide a little. The atmosphere was magic and it was good to be back to live league football.
